Xbox Live (trademarked as Xbox LIVE) is the online gaming service created by Microsoft for the Xbox, Xbox 360 and Xbox One. It costs about $50 USD per year (in America) and has over 31 million subscribers as of 2013. There are two versions of Xbox Live; Gold and Free. Free allows an online 'friends list' and downloads, but does not allow users to play games against other people online. Gold is the same as Free, but with the addition of online gaming and cost $50/£40 a year. Subscribers can pay with a credit card or by special cards which are bought in shops and enter the codes online.

Microsoft Points

Microsoft Points or MS points was the previous currency of Xbox Live. In 2013 they changed it to actual currency such as Dollars or Euros. On Xbox Live you can buy many things ranging from movies to games to DLC. You can buy full games on Xbox 360 and Xbox One or Xbox Live Arcade games.
